Price isn’t the only thing that you should look at when looking for a new place to relocate your home. Your life doesn’t just revolve around staying at home but there are activities, needs and wants that you need to consider. First of all, if you have someone who is still studying in your family, consider that distance of your home from nearby schools and universities. Emergency cases and accidents should be prepared for because it involves the lives of your family members. Make sure that there’s a hospital near your home to make sure that help will come faster. Supplies such as toiletries, groceries and utility tools are also important so having a supermarket just near your home will be better. Not only that it’s efficient but it also helps in cutting off your gasoline expenses. The atmosphere and friendliness of your neighborhood is healthy for you and your family so take some time to take a look around if you see your family growing up in your new home.
